Several tools have been developed and are available on Unix to do this, including sed and AWK. During this course you will be trained to process large files with sed and AWK. Sed is tool enabling to select and process lines. You can easily insert, delete, modify, append lines to very large files with millions of lines. AWK will enable to perform more fine tuned file modifications based on columns. It includes also more mathematical and string functions. Nous présenterons les étapes bioinformatiques nécessaires pour nettoyer les données brutes et les caractériser d’un point de vue taxonomique. Nous aborderons ensuite les différentes stratégies à employer pour assembler les reads et obtenir des comptages sur des gènes prédits. Enfin nous présenterons quelques outils pour obtenir une annotation fonctionnelle des échantillons. A l’issue des 2 jours de formation, les stagiaires connaîtront le périmètre, les avantages et limites des analyses de données de séquençage shotgun. Ils seront capables d’utiliser les outils présentés sur les jeux de données de la formation.
